Collection Efficiency Of Non-Banking Lenders Met Pre-COVID Level: ICRA

The Investment Information and Credit Rating Agency on February 22 revealed that non-banking lenders attained a collection efficiency in retail loan pools, reaching pre-COVID levels. ICRA cited the improvements in economic activity ensuring borrower's repaying capacity and dedicated recovery efforts by lenders as the reason behind surge. Farmers' Protest: Toll Plazas Suffering Rs 1.8 Cr Loss/Day

The public-funded toll plazas across Punjab, Haryana, and Delhi-NCR are undergoing a loss of Rs 1.8 crore a day due to farmers' protest stated Union Transport Minister Nitin Gadkari. Reportedly, the loss that started in October 2020 has intensified to the zero-fee collection since December. Earlier, reports by rating agency ICRA had estimated loss of Rs 600 crore due to protests as 52 toll plazas were predicted to be affected.
